Interviews can feel nerve-wracking, but with the right preparation, you can impress any employer. An interview is simply a conversation to check if your skills, attitude and experience match the role. To make the process easier, follow these key steps:

Before the Interview

  • Confirm details - Check the date, time and whether it’s in-person, phone or video.

  • Study the job description – Understand the skills and experience the employer wants.

  • Research the company – Visit their website, learn about their work culture and projects.

  • Review your CV – Prepare examples that highlight your strengths and achievements.

  • Practise common questions –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) for clear answers.

On the Day of the Interview

  • Reach early – Helps you stay calm and focused.

  • Dress professionally – Make a good first impression.

  • Keep phone silent – Avoid distractions.

  • For online interviews – Check your internet, device and join 5–10 minutes early.

During the Interview

  • Listen carefully and ask for clarification if needed.

  • Use your prepared examples to answer confidently.

  • Ask thoughtful questions at the end about the role or company.

After the Interview

  • Follow up politely with an email if needed.

  • If not selected, request feedback and work on improvement.

This preparation increases your confidence and helps you perform your best.
